ABSTRACT

The expenses related to the foundations of an offshore wind farm constitute about one third of the total cost. For wind turbines located on deeper waters, the cost of the foundations might be even higher. Thus, a new technology is needed to reduce the total cost of offshore wind turbines. This technology could be the bucket foundation. The first part of the seabed penetration is caused by self-weight. Secondly, suction is applied inside the bucket chamber. The suction creates a differential pressure across the bucket lid, effectively increasing the downward force on the bucket while the water flow reduces the skirt tip resistance. As a result, this foundation does not require heavy installation equipment.
